At Help at Hand Support, we understand the vital importance of social connections in adding to the overall quality and richness of our participants’ lives. That’s why we recently hosted a fun-filled event for NDIS participants, and it was a blast!

The event concept was born out of an idea our staff had for getting NDIS participants together to create social connections, have something fun and maybe a little different to look forward to and to acknowledge our appreciation for them in a tangible way.

The sun was shining (albeit the wind could have been less energetic, so our balloons didn’t want to fly away!) and the atmosphere was buzzing with excitement as participants from all walks of life came together. Here’s a glimpse into the day’s festivities:


Sizzling with Good Times:

What better way to bring people together than by having an epic sausage sizzle. If people didn’t notice our distinctive orange and black balloon display, the smell of the BBQ definitely let them know they were in the right spot! Having the event as a “Picnic in the Park” at lunchtime was a great opportunity to grab a bite, relax, and chat with fellow participants and our friendly support team.

Games Galore!

Laughter and cheers filled the air as participants got competitive (in the best way possible!) with some classic outdoor games. From beanbag tossing to lawn darts, there was something for everyone to enjoy, regardless of ability. It was a fantastic way to get active, have some fun, and bond with others.

Brain Games too:

For those that prefer to exercise their brains, we had a specially made Music Memory Card Game. The lively game session was a great way to challenge ourselves, talk about our favourite musicians, and enjoy some giggles. There were also Mandala colouring books and pencils available for those who preferred a more calming activity.

Building Connections:

Most importantly, the event provided a valuable opportunity for the NDIS participants who attended to connect with other members of the community.

Maggie* (*named changed for Privacy) commented that she loved attending the event, as usually after her weekly physiotherapy appointment on Wednesday, she would just go straight home and probably watch TV. “Getting outside and having somewhere new to go to, was different and really fun” she told us.

At Help at Hand Support, we’re committed to fostering a sense of community and belonging for all NDIS participants. This event was a fantastic example of that commitment in action.
